Key findings
Tribunal's reasoningThe claimant had been ordered to pay a deposit of £400 following a preliminary hearing held on 26 September 2023. The order was sent to the claimant on 3 October 2023.
The tribunal recorded that the claimant failed to pay the deposit. The claim was therefore struck out under rule 39(4) of the Employment Tribunals Rules of Procedure 2013, and the hearing listed for 13-14 March 2023 was vacated.
